we just started to venture into partitioning slots, the set-up on one machine
is pretty simple right now:
SLOT_TYPE_1 = cpu=4, ram=7800, swap=30%
NUM_SLOTS_TYPE_1 = 1
SLOT_TYPE_1_PARTITIONABLE = True
This slot is then advertised correctly. However, running a couple of jobs and
we see that the "partitioned slots" are not returned to the pool:
gpu016:~# condor_status -direct testhost
Name OpSys Arch State Activity LoadAv Mem
ActvtyTime
slot1@xxxxxxxxxxxx LINUX X86_64 Owner Idle 0.000 6775
0+00:44:47
slot1_1@xxxxxxxxxx LINUX X86_64 Claimed Busy 0.000 1024
0+00:16:16
slot1_2@xxxxxxxxxx LINUX X86_64 Owner Idle 0.000 1
0+00:21:50
Total Owner Claimed Unclaimed Matched Preempting Backfill
X86_64/LINUX 3 2 1 0 0 0 0
Total 3 2 1 0 0 0 0
slot 1_2 was not used for about 30 minutes now, slots1_1 was idle before and a
new job took that slot again - however, this is pretty bad, as the new job
only requested a single core and slot1_1 had 3 cores reserved.
I cannot find anything about configuring the return into Condor, thus I assume
it should *just* happen, any idea what's wrong here?
